Abstract: Answering a question of Wilf, we show that if is sufficiently large, then one cannot cover an rectangle using each of the distinct Ferrers shapes of size exactly once. Moreover, the maximum number of pairwise distinct, non-overlapping Ferrers shapes that can be packed in such a rectangle is only
